Hepato-biliary-pancreatic pathology
Summary
This group’s main area of interest is the study of diseases associated with the liver, in particular complications involving liver transplants, cirrhosis, hepatitis B and C, liver and pancreatic cancer.
The approach is mainly of a clinical nature, with patient studies and epidemiological (populational) studies on the characteristics that correlate with the prognoses, and the causes of treatment complications. The relevance of the group’s research is clear. On the one hand, pancreatic cancer has one of the worst prognoses due to it being difficult to diagnose, and on the other hand, due to the central position of the liver metabolism in the human body.
